A comprehensive introduction to reliability and availability modeling, analysis, and design at the system, hardware, and software levels

Reliability of Computer Systems and Networks presents the fundamentals of reliability and availability analysis for various computer hardware, software, and networked systems. Reliability and availability as major objectives in system design are the focus. Various redundancy and fault-tolerant techniques, as well as error-correcting coding techniques are treated.

The author proposes a high-level design approach based on apportioning the reliability and availability goals to subsystems and provides various techniques for achieving these subsystem goals. The next step is an efficient, exact optimization approach based on upper and lower bounds to minimize the number of feasible candidates. The most readily applied methods for analysis are utilized and design techniques are derived from basic principles. Analytical simplifications and approximations are developed to validate the results of computer models used for large-scale complex problems.

Coverage includes:

  • Coding and decoding schemes for error detection and correction including chip reliability
  • Comparison of the reliability and availability of parallel, standby, and majority voting architectures
  • Formulation, solution, and interpretation of Markov models for repairable systems
  • Introduction and comparison of various RAID memory systems
  • The architecture and fault-tolerant principles of TANDEM and STRATUS non-stop computer systems
  • Practical and tutorial examples and numerous practice problems
  • Appendices which cover the necessary background material on probability, reliability, and architecture

Reliability of Computer Systems and Networks offers in-depth and up-to-date coverage of reliability and availability for students with a focus on important applications areas, computer systems, and networks. Professionals in systems and reliability design, as well as computer architecture, will find it a highly useful reference.
